Teaching Methods

The teaching methods aim at the global understanding of the subjects and learning autonomy, complemented by in-depth learning of two specialty subjects. The students are encouraged to study each subject individually, and after each study period a discussion session takes place with the students and professor. Each student presents two subjects, written and orally, to deepen his/her knowledge of two subjects of his/her choice.

Learning Outcomes

This course is designed to offer advanced scientific training, enabling individual research, in chemical reactivity and dynamics. The students are expected to become autonomous in the search and critical analysis of relevant literature, in the understanding and formulation of chemical reactivity models, and the oral and written presentation of the fundamental concepts in this area.

Syllabus

1. Colisions and Molecular Dinamics.

2. Reativity in Thermalized Systems.

Transition State Theory. Intersecting State Model.

3. Structure - Reativity relationships.

4. Unimolecular reactions.

5. Elementary reactions.

6. Reactions on surfaces.

7. Substitution reactions.

8. Chain reactions.

9. Proton transfer reactions.

10. Enzymatic catalysis.

11. Transitions  Between electronic states.

12. Electron transfer reactions.

13. Caos and oscillatiory reactions.
